I have this somewhere on my old computer, in a different state, at my parents house, 1000 something miles away but I've been dying to listen to it again. These versions are from two nights in Vancouver when they were touring HIPT I'm pretty sure. Raine is playing acoustic guitar alone and Steve is doing some really simple dreamy melodic stuff underneath then the band comes in.. During the bridge raine makes the crowd sing and it's SO loud.. Such a great live moment.

Does anyone have this on hand that they could please send me?
